Unveiling the DUV Optical Lens Frontier

Deep ultraviolet optical lenses represent the cornerstone of contemporary photolithography processes, enabling the patterning of semiconductor devices at ever-shrinking feature sizes. As chipmakers race toward advanced nodes, the precision and reliability of DUV optics dictate manufacturing yields, throughput, and overall cost efficiency. This report explores how breakthroughs in lens design, materials science, and coating technologies have converged to meet the stringent demands of 193 nm and 248 nm lithographic systems.

In light of intensifying competition among fabrication facilities, lens suppliers have accelerated innovation cycles to reduce aberrations, extend depth of focus, and enhance transmission. These developments play a pivotal role in the semiconductor value chain, influencing the performance of etching, inspection, and critical overlay applications. By examining both mature and emerging markets, this executive summary illuminates the forces shaping demand for achromatic, aspheric, cylindrical, and spherical lens configurations across the global landscape.

Shifting Paradigms in Deep Ultraviolet Lithography

The semiconductor industry has undergone transformative shifts driven by relentless scaling goals and the push toward heterogenous integration. Amid this evolution, deep ultraviolet lithography continues to hold strategic importance even as extreme ultraviolet adoption gains momentum. Manufacturers are optimizing DUV toolsets to serve mature nodes, high-volume manufacturing, and specialized applications that cannot justify the capital intensity of EUV.

Simultaneously, advancements in lens materials and ultra-low thermal expansion glasses have elevated performance metrics and extended maintenance cycles. Suppliers now integrate novel anti-reflection and protective coatings to guard against contamination and radiation damage, thereby enhancing uptime. These technological strides coincide with a rise in demand for inspection lenses that detect sub-20 nm defects, reflecting an industrywide focus on yield optimization.

Furthermore, the convergence of photolithography with emerging high-numerical-aperture processes has prompted a reassessment of optical designs. Collaborative development between fabless design houses and lens manufacturers has yielded solutions tailored to specialized use cases, such as image sensors and power semiconductors. As a result, the DUV landscape is characterized by flexible, application-specific product lines that deliver targeted performance improvements.

Assessing the Ripple Effects of US Tariffs in 2025

The implementation of new tariff regimes by the United States in 2025 has introduced fresh complexities into the semiconductor supply chain. Optical lens suppliers face increased duties on key raw materials and finished components, driving up procurement costs and compelling firms to reassess sourcing strategies. These levies have had a ripple effect, pushing manufacturers to explore alternative glass substrates and reevaluate logistics channels to maintain cost competitiveness.

Rising import costs have prompted several suppliers to accelerate regional manufacturing capabilities, particularly in Asia-Pacific and Americas, to mitigate exposure to cross-border duties. At the same time, assemblers and test service providers are reevaluating inventory policies to avoid stockouts and the cascading impact on wafer fab throughput. Heightened duties have underscored the need for flexible supply chains that can pivot swiftly in response to tariff adjustments.

As companies adapt their procurement frameworks, collaborative partnerships and joint ventures are gaining prominence. Suppliers are forging deeper relationships with foundries and integrated device manufacturers to secure volume commitments and share the burden of tariff-induced cost inflation. In parallel, ongoing dialogue with policymakers aims to clarify tariff classifications and minimize disruptions to critical semiconductor manufacturing equipment transactions.

Decoding Market Segments Shaping DUV Lens Demand

The market analysis segments reveal divergent growth trajectories across applications, products, wafer sizes, wavelengths, coatings, and end-user categories. From an application perspective, photolithography drives the largest share of demand, while etching and inspection workflows increasingly leverage specialized DUV optics to enhance precision at advanced nodes. Product type segmentation underscores the significance of achromatic lenses for broad-band imaging and aspheric variants for aberration correction, with cylindrical and spherical components filling niche alignment and overlay roles.

Wafer size remains a critical factor, as 300 mm fabs continue to dominate high-volume manufacturing, yet 200 mm and 150 mm facilities sustain robust demand for legacy and specialized device production. Wavelength analysis highlights the transition from 248 nm systems toward optimized 193 nm exposure tools, reflecting efforts to achieve finer resolution. Coating strategies also play an instrumental role, with anti-reflection layers boosting throughput by minimizing optical losses and protective films preserving lens integrity under harsh ultraviolet exposure.

End-user segmentation captures the distinct requirements of fabless companies, which prioritize design flexibility, versus foundries and integrated device manufacturers that emphasize volume capacity and reliability. Outsourced assembly and test providers complete the ecosystem, demanding optics that support rapid yield diagnostics. By weaving these insights together, the report delineates how each segment influences investment, R&D focus, and long-term partnerships within the DUV optical lens market.

Regional Dynamics Driving Growth Trajectories

Regional dynamics exert a profound influence on the semiconductor DUV optical lens landscape as supply chains and manufacturing hubs evolve. In the Americas, a resurgence of onshore fabrication investment is driving lens suppliers to establish or expand local production facilities, thereby reducing lead times and insulating operations from logistical disruptions. This shift supports government initiatives aiming to strengthen domestic chipmaking capabilities and foster resilience against geopolitical uncertainties.

Across Europe, the Middle East, and Africa, collaboration between state-backed research institutions and industry consortia accelerates photolithography innovation. Initiatives centered on sustainable manufacturing practices, including energy-efficient coating processes and circular economy models for lens refurbishment, are gaining traction. These efforts position the region as a testbed for advanced optics while complementing broader semiconductor ecosystem developments in wafer fabrication and equipment manufacturing.

Asia-Pacific continues to dominate in both demand and production, buoyed by expansive manufacturing clusters in Taiwan, South Korea, and China. Lens suppliers here benefit from proximity to key foundry partners and a concentration of specialized glass manufacturers. At the same time, emerging markets in Southeast Asia and India are attracting investment in test and packaging facilities, creating new growth corridors for optics tailored to smaller wafer sizes and niche applications.

Competitive Edge Through Leading Industry Players

Leading global manufacturers and emerging challengers are shaping the competitive environment for DUV optical lenses through targeted investments and strategic partnerships. Established incumbents have reinforced their positions by expanding R&D budgets to develop advanced glass formulations and precision polishing techniques. Concurrently, agile newcomers from materials science start to capture market share by offering customizable lens geometries with rapid prototyping capabilities.

Collaborative ventures between lens providers and lithography equipment OEMs have become commonplace, aiming to optimize system-level performance and streamline qualification processes. These relationships enable end users to access fully validated optical modules with guaranteed compatibility, shortening integration timelines and reducing risk. Moreover, strategic alliances with coating specialists have yielded proprietary anti-reflection and durability treatments, ensuring lenses meet increasingly stringent cleanliness and longevity standards.

As supply chain resilience gains emphasis, select players are investing in redundant manufacturing sites and vertical integration of critical glass substrates. This shift not only mitigates geopolitical and tariff-related risks but also accelerates time to market for urgent capacity expansions. Through a blend of technological innovation and supply chain optimization, the key players are setting a high bar for performance and reliability in the DUV optical lens sector.
